这个需求是改之前的WebService,使之Rsa加密传输。聊天方式是解释域Id认证,文档和实现是我在写,想法是他在定。所以对于WebService HttpWebResponse方式,我该怎么认证这个连接实现第一次握手。
我这边是搞服务接口。这个需求是改之前的WebService,使之Rsa加密传输。聊天方式是解释域Id认证,文档和实现是我在写,想法是他在定。所以对于WebService HttpWebResponse方式,我该怎么认证这个连接实现第一次握手。
[quote=引用 15 楼 xomix 的回复:] 顺嘴说一下微软深度合作的客户一般都采用windows登陆到网站,你windows登陆后是可以自动把你的域信息带到ie或edge登陆的iis里面的并且是可以获取到的。 你最好确认一下对方是不是让你做这些。
[quote=引用 10 楼 本人QQ-554433626 的回复:] 我这边是搞服务接口。这个需求是改之前的WebService,使之Rsa加密传输。聊天方式是解释域Id认证,文档和实现是我在写,想法是他在定。所以对于WebService HttpWebResponse方式,我该怎么认证这个连接实现第一次握手。
顺嘴说一下微软深度合作的客户一般都采用windows登陆到网站,你windows登陆后是可以自动把你的域信息带到ie或edge登陆的iis里面的并且是可以获取到的。 你最好确认一下对方是不是让你做这些。
不纠结什么“域”,你们的协议过程到底是什么。 比如说服务端开发者给所有客户端开发者一个文档,里边写着string Login(string username, string password);这样一个接口定义,那么客户端开发程序员就可以使用var token = server.Login("张三", "1234abcd");这样的方式登录,或者是var token = server.Login("MyDomain\张三", "1234abcd");这样的方式登录。这就是纠结“域ID”的差别而已,但是服务端的开发人凭什么让客户端“你认证一下”呢?
string Login(string username, string password);
var token = server.Login("张三", "1234abcd");
var token = server.Login("MyDomain\张三", "1234abcd");
关键是这个问题的背景是什么背景? 如果你的电脑本身没有加入windows域,别人却空谈域ID,那么你可以忽略。
如图。域ID认证。搞不懂域ID是什么,怎么取!!
62,242
社区成员
668,999
社区内容
加载中
.NET 社区是一个围绕开源 .NET 的开放、热情、创新、包容的技术社区。社区致力于为广大 .NET 爱好者提供一个良好的知识共享、协同互助的 .NET 技术交流环境。我们尊重不同意见,支持健康理性的辩论和互动,反对歧视和攻击。
希望和大家一起共同营造一个活跃、友好的社区氛围。
试试用AI创作助手写篇文章吧